Transaction 151f366c5cc9029062273c0948e4556fa066f8b960356fd036dd23a403771cdc

2 Input
2 Outputs
  • 151f366c5cc9029062273c0948e4556fa066f8b960356fd036dd23a403771cdc:0
  • value  23720000
    address  18wzabAMYRfjca13z4B5Pn1ZJaXQiC91V6
  • 151f366c5cc9029062273c0948e4556fa066f8b960356fd036dd23a403771cdc:1
  • value  14935677
    address  19iVyH1qUxgywY8LJSbpV4VavjZmyuEyxV